**TICKET: BranchReaper config drift on plugin sandboxes**

Plugin authors: BranchReaper instances in the Quellhaven sandbox have drifted from the canonical spec. Stale-branch thresholds no longer match what your hooks expect, so cleanup fires early. Pin your plugin against the canonical values until drift reconciliation lands next sprint. The expected configuration is as follows.

config for kagup-hahig:
druwyn:
  pin: 2801
  metrics_host: metrics.druwyn.zemvarlabs.internal
  tenant: sorius
  seal: seal_798a43d7

Ticket GH-providence: The Fernhaus greenhouse controller has been drifting — humidity sensors reading 8% high since the firmware bump. Calibration offsets live in the Mosskeep vault, but the vault auto-locked after too many failed unlocks (sorry, that was me). Future maintainers: to reopen Mosskeep and pull the calibration table, run the unlock tool and enter the recovery passphrase shown immediately below.

strongbox words: zordor-quenax

Subject: Key rotation for EchoDocent audio-guide backend

Team,

As part of the quarterly rotation, the credential used by the EchoDocent app to reach the internal TrackServe streaming service was replaced this morning. The old key stops working Friday. Please confirm during review that no branches still reference the retired value in config fixtures. The new key for the staging environment follows.

service key, fahag-kahag: zpat7_r6DmLJu

Subject: Canary gating cut-over — done

Hi Renate — the cut-over of canary deploy gating on the Oxbridge pipeline completed this morning. Gating decisions now come from the Lintvale rules engine instead of the old static thresholds. Error-rate and latency gates fire automatically; manual promotion stays available as an override for the next two releases. Rollback tested and clean. For your release notes, the gating rules engine is currently running with these configuration values.

deployment values, yadug-bawif:
[framir]
team = pelox
access_code = ac_a38ab2
owner = tamion.julael
host = framir.tolvaqlabs.test
port = 11211
peer = tammir.zemvargrid.local
salt = 2215ef03
pin = 1541